>  3) Use Annotations to handle mounting.  Instead of putting all mount logic
>  in the Application class, you could annotate your pages with something like
>  @Mount( strategy=foo.class, params=x,y,z ).  Then upon initialization,
>  Wicket could scan the class path and auto-mount these annotated pages.
>  Scanning the classpath is pretty easy using some spring-core functionality.
>  I don't know if the Spring license is compatible with Apache, so this might
>  need to be a contrib feature.

Spring uses the Apache License, v2
